GE Aerospace is one of the world’s premier aerospace companies, specializing in the design, manufacturing, and servicing of jet engines, propulsion systems, and integrated aircraft technologies. The company supports both commercial aviation and defense customers, powering aircraft used by airlines, the U.S. military, and allied forces around the world. With a legacy rooted in over a century of aviation innovation, GE Aerospace plays a central role in advancing the future of flight across efficiency, performance, and sustainability.
